The U.S. state of Texas issues marriage licenses to same-sex couples and recognizes those marriages when performed out-of-state. On June 26, 2015, the United States legalized same-sex marriage nationwide due to the U.S. Supreme Court's decision in Obergefell v.

Following the threat of a court order and action from County Attorney Vince Ryan, Stanart began issuing marriage licenses at 3 p.m. on June 26. 47 same-sex couples were issued licenses in Houston that day, starting with John LaRue and Hunter Middleton.
